Team U16c Championship County Final Valley Rovers 4-6 to Ballinascarthy 0-4 On Saturday Valleys U16 captured an another county title in an Historic year for the entire Parish. The girls took on Ballinascarthy in the U16c Final played in Camogie head quarters Castle Rd. Ballinascarthy were first to score with an early point from play. Valleys equalized shortly with a Laura Brew free. Both team remained dead locked for the next seven to eight minutes with play swinging from end to end. Ballinascarthy were next to score with a pointed free. In the following two minutes Valleys had two goals which were to have a major turning point in the match. Laura Brew gathered the puck out from Ballinascarthy score and her shot dipped just under the crossbar for her first goal of the game. Within a minute Valleys were awarded a free from mid field and Michelle Cottrell's shot also dipped under the crossbar for a second similar goal. Valleys played with great confidence after these goals and great defence work broke up several Ballinascarthy efforts with goalkeeper Ciara Murphy making some vital saves. Valleys work rate was rewarded with a Grace O Reilly goal before half time leaving the half time score 3-1 to 0-2 in Valleys favour. Ballinascarthy started the second half in blistering fashion and two certain goal chances were saved on the line with brilliant goalkeeping and many more attacks cleared by the backs. it was heart breaking for Ballinascarthy not to score in this period. Valleys added two further points before Laura Brew's 45 dipped under the crossbar for her second goal of the game. Valleys forwards worked tirelessly for the entire game and added two more points. Great combined defensive from all six backs limited Ballinascarthy to just one point in the second half.
